The Audi repair market for Wellington, Missouri, residents is entirely reliant on the Kansas City metropolitan area, located approximately 60-70 miles to the west. The quality of specialized service available is exceptionally high, as Kansas City supports a competitive market of independent European auto specialists. These shops compete directly with dealerships by offering comparable expertise, often with more personalized service and at a lower labor rate. **Competition Level:** High among specialists. Customers have multiple top-tier options, which drives a focus on quality and customer service. **Average Quality:** Very High for specialized shops. General mechanics in the Wellington area are not equipped with the proprietary tools or training for complex Audi systems.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ates at these specialist shops typically range from $150-$190 per hour, which is significantly below dealer rates but above those of general repair shops. This reflects the high level of expertise and investment in specialized equipment required. Parts costs are generally consistent, though these shops often provide access to high-quality aftermarket or OEM options not available at standard auto parts stores.
